enum
{
AIO_CANCELED,
AIO_NOTCANCELED,
AIO_ALLDONE
}
;
#define AIO_ALLDONE AIO_ALLDONE
#define AIO_CANCELED AIO_CANCELED
#define AIO_NOTCANCELED AIO_NOTCANCELED
enum
{
LIO_READ,
LIO_WRITE,
LIO_NOP
}
;
#define LIO_NOP LIO_NOP
#define LIO_READ LIO_READ
#define LIO_WAIT LIO_WAIT
enum
{
LIO_WAIT,
LIO_NOWAIT
}
;
#define LIO_NOWAIT LIO_NOWAIT
#define LIO_WRITE LIO_WRITE
struct aiocb
{
int aio_fildes;
int aio_lio_opcode;
int aio_reqprio;
void *aio_buf;
size_t aio_nbytes;
Unknown Type:".." aio_sigevent;
struct aiocb *__next_prio;
int __abs_prio;
int __policy;
int __error_code;
__ssize_t __return_value;
__off_t aio_offset;
char __pad[1];
char __unused[1];
}
;
struct aiocb64
{
int aio_fildes;
int aio_lio_opcode;
int aio_reqprio;
void *aio_buf;
size_t aio_nbytes;
Unknown Type:".." aio_sigevent;
struct aiocb *__next_prio;
int __abs_prio;
int __policy;
int __error_code;
__ssize_t __return_value;
__off64_t aio_offset;
char __unused[1];
}
; |